If you installed your doorbell in the Google Nest app, then you have the 1st gen Google Nest Hello Doorbell. (We have 3 of those.)  I'm surprised that you got that from the Google website yesterday, since your link points to the 2nd gen doorbells, and they're supposedly not selling Nest Hellos anymore.

FYI: You can view 1st gen cameras and doorbells in the Google Home app and view event history, but you can't see 24/7 history and you can't change Settings. You can also livestream 1st gen cameras and doorbells on the home.google.com website. For full access to 1st gen cameras and doorbells, you need to use the Google Nest app and the home.nest.com website.

Google Nest is in the middle of a very gradual process of letting customers try out moving some of their 1st gen cameras from the Google Nest app to the "Public Preview" version of the Google Home app, but if you do so, you'll lose many of the functions available only in the Google Nest app (https://support.google.com/googlenest/answer/13038234#zippy=%2Cnest-app-only-features😞
